Curb Appeal is Important for Museums

Although retail businesses typically worry more about curb appeal than facilities like museums, you shouldn't ignore the importance of proper presentation. If you let your museum look old or run down, there's a good chance that you may miss out on a variety of customers.

For example, someone may pass up your museum for another one like it if that museum looks more attractive. This fact is true even if your facility has better items to display and takes care of them better than other facilities. Remember: presentation matters in any kind of business.

As a result, you need to make sure that you sit down and really think about how you can improve your curb appeal. One easy way to perform this step is to paint the exterior of your museum and add brighter and more appealing colors. However, you also need to make sure that your colors properly match.

Proper Paint Matching Matters

Paint colors can either complement each other or clash and create unappealing looks and styles that are hard to maintain. For example, you may add red and green paints to your museum exterior and negatively affect its style. You may also choose a paint type that simply doesn't match either.

For example, you shouldn't match one brand of paint with another because they often have slightly different textures. You also need to make sure that the type of paint also matches, such as matching oil-solvent paints other types of paints of the same category.

Therefore, it is critical to take the time to properly match your paint.
